def _sanitize_column(self, key, value, broadcast=True):
"""
Ensures new columns (which go into the BlockManager as new blocks) are
always copied and converted into an array.

Parameters
----------
key : object
value : scalar, Series, or array-like
broadcast : bool, default True
If ``key`` matches multiple duplicate column names in the
DataFrame, this parameter indicates whether ``value`` should be
tiled so that the returned array contains a (duplicated) column for
each occurrence of the key. If False, ``value`` will not be tiled.

Returns
-------
sanitized_column : numpy-array
"""

def test_insert_with_columns_dups(self):
# GH 14291
df = pd.DataFrame()
df.insert(0, 'A', ['g', 'h', 'i'], allow_duplicates=True)
df.insert(0, 'A', ['d', 'e', 'f'], allow_duplicates=True)
df.insert(0, 'A', ['a', 'b', 'c'], allow_duplicates=True)
exp = pd.DataFrame([['a', 'd', 'g'], ['b', 'e', 'h'],
['c', 'f', 'i']], columns=['A', 'A', 'A'])
assert_frame_equal(df, exp)
